Why is there such a great drought in California? Join Master Gardener, David Peterson to learn the causes and what this means for your garden.

You will learn how to protect your garden during a drought; how to use water more efficiently; how to grow vegetables successfully; and how to use native and Mediterranean plants that are naturally adapted to low-water climates. Bring your questions!
